If you carry out any of the following treatments, you must be registered with the Council under the Local Government (Miscellaneous Provisions) Act 1982:

  • Acupuncture
  • Tattooing
  • Ear Piercing
  • Body Piercing
  • Electrolysis

Who Needs to Register

Both the practitioner (the person performing the treatment) and the premises where the treatment takes place must be registered with the Council before any procedures are carried out.

Initially, the premises must be licensed along with at least one practitioner. Once this registration is in place, additional practitioners can apply for a personal licence to operate from that registered premises.

This requirement applies to all individuals and businesses offering these treatments, whether operating from a fixed location, mobile unit, or visiting clients in their homes.

How to Apply

To apply for registration, you will need to complete the relevant application form and pay the applicable fee.

The same form and fee apply for both personal and premises licences. The current fee is £184.

Once you have completed your application, you can submit it in one of the following ways:

  • By email: Send your completed form to licensing@fylde.gov.uk. A member of the Licensing Team will contact you to arrange payment.
  • In person: Submit your form and make payment at the Town Hall reception.

After we receive your application and payment, we will contact you to arrange an inspection of the premises.

Health and Safety Standards

Before registration is approved, our Health and Safety Officer will inspect the premises to ensure that it meets the required standards for cleanliness, hygiene, waste disposal, and infection control. Practitioners must also demonstrate knowledge of safe working practices and infection prevention.

Failure to register or comply with hygiene standards may result in enforcement action, including fines or closure of the business.
